    A Natural England commissoined verification survey of intertidal sediments within the Beachy Head West rMCZ. Phase I Biotope mapping was carried out across the rMCZ for broad scale habitats where intertidal coarse sediment occurred. Phase II Infaunal sampling was carried out to provide information on the benthic infaunal assemblages and particle size distribution of the study sites by means of core sampling. Sediment surface scrapes were obtained for heavy metals and organic contaminants analysis. The data was used to produce a EUNIS Level 3 boradscale habitat map of the Beachy Head West rMCZ. Aerial imagery and OS mapping was digitised to produce baseline maps of biotope boundaries. The maps were annotated in the field to identify biotopes and boundaries as well as significant features. In addition, intertidal sediment cores were taken at 6 stations (0.01m2 cores 3 replicates at each station) distributed throughout the Beachy Head West rMCZ, in order to assess the benthic species present, along with an additional sample for Particle Size Analysis. Samples were sieved over a 0.5mm sieve. Sediment scrape samples were also taken at 3 stations for Tributyl tin, heavy metal and organic contaminant analysis. The methods used for data collection and processing followed protocols and standards for biotope mapping and sampling. MEDIN Data Guideline for sediment sampling by grab or core for benthos.

    A Natural England commissioned verification survey. Littoral biotope survey and condition assessment of the Tamar, Tavy & St John's Lake SSSI. The purpose of the study was to establish a physical and biological baseline dataset to facilitate an assessment of favourable condition status of littoral sediment habitats of the SSSI site, as well as identifying species and biotopes that are representative and/or notable within the Tamar, Tavy & St John's Lake. The study comprised of Phase I and Phase II surveys. Phase I comprised of groundtruthing aerial photography to establish the distribution and extent of intertidal biotopes, interest features and species. Followed by Phase II; detailed descriptions of biotopes present , flora and fauna species list and abundance, as well as sediment characteristics by means of box-core sampling. The data was used to produce a detailed biotope map of the Tamar, Tavy & St John's Lake.

    Finescale EUNIS habitat map covering ~50 sq km lying SSW of the Isle of Wight, half way between the UK 12 NM line and the UK/France median line. Aimed at provifiding fine, nested detail within a broader study identifying Annex I 'Rocky reef' habitats. Based on expert interpretation of 100% multibeam coverage supported by directed ground truth sampling (video and still images), Benthic Terrain Modeller and QTC View analysis applied to single-beam digital bathymetry (licensed from SeaZone), and the BGS seabed sediments chart modified according to the simplified 4-class Folk trigion used by MESH and EUNIS (Coarse, Mixed, Sand, Mud).

    Broadscale EUNIS habitat map covering ~3,800 sq km lying >12 km off the Isle of Wight, to the UK/France median line. Aimed at identifying Annex I 'Rocky reef' habitats. Based on expert interpretation of multiple data sets including Benthic Terrain Modeller applied to full-coverage single-beam digital bathymetry (licensed from SeaZone), complementary Cefas acoustic surveys with directed ground truth sampling (video and still images), and the BGS seabed sediments chart modified according to the simplified 4-class Folk trigion used by MESH and EUNIS (Coarse, Mixed, Sand, Mud).

    Seabed facies interpretation (Sally Philpott, BGS) of area 12km x 4km east of the Isle of Wight, adjacent to Nab Tower, based on 100% side scan cover obtained in August 1998. The interpretation also referred to BGS historical sediment data for the area, and point ground-truth samples.
